THESIS: Trends in Higher Education Systems in International Spheres
THESIS Podcast
45 episodes
1 day ago
The THESIS podcast aims to explore higher education across the globe through a range of perspectives, discuss relevant topics in a critical and digestible manner, and contribute to discourse among students, scholars and experts in the higher education field. It is organized and produced by several students in University of Oslo’s Master of Philosophy in Higher Education’s 2021 cohort who come from across the world who have an array of experiences and interests in the Higher Education field.

Egyptian students: Popular international student recruits from the MENA region
THESIS: Trends in Higher Education Systems in International Spheres
19 minutes 3 seconds
1 year ago
Egyptian students: Popular international student recruits from the MENA region

Today we speak with Dalia Elgohary, International Relations Executive at EDUGATE, a company based in Egypt hosting Egypt’s largest University fair. We discuss destinations of interest for Egyptian students and reasons why higher education students from Egypt choose to study in different countries, from her perspective.
